Is there an easy and effective way, perhaps a plug in, that loads a series of Effects Favourites in After Effects. eg. I have a sequence of effects (6-10) to achieve the results i want. I have saved them as Favourites. But if i have multiple footage that i'd like to be processed with these in it's sequential order. Aside from saving a standard comp with an adjustment layer and/or just loading each effects favourite... is there a simpler way? Like a "Effects Favourite Manager/Compiler"? One click and all is applied to a layer? A cheap solution too, if at all it cost any money...

replace footage?
 
Load any piece of video into your timeline. Apply the effects in the order you like. Save the composition. Then option drag a new piece of video onto the old video clip to replace the original footage with the new footage. Render.

Perhaps this is a little too obvious and a little clunky. Have you tried posting in Adobe's AE forum? That's where all the heavyweights hang out.
